Lighter has reached a pivotal moment in its development by officially launching its public mainnet after an extensive eight-month private beta phase. This launch not only signifies the readiness of the platform but also positions Lighter as a formidable contender in the decentralized finance (DeFi) sector. According to the conclusions drawn in the analytical report, the platform is expected to attract significant user interest and investment.
Lighter Protocol Overview
The Lighter protocol is built on Ethereum Layer 2 and utilizes custom zero-knowledge (ZK) circuits, which are designed to provide users with low-latency and cost-effective trading options. This technological foundation aims to enhance the overall trading experience, making it more accessible and efficient for users.
